perbedaan PHP dan HTML

Setelah kita mengetahui pengertian dan sejarah HTML dan PHP pada postingan saya sebelumnya,,sekarang kita akan membahas apa sih bedanya PHP dengan HTML??

Dokumen html adalah dokumen [[HyperTextMmarkupLanguage]] yang akan tampil jika diaktifasikan oleh suatu tautan atau link yang di klik oleh user. Dokumen ini kemudian dibaca oleh browser.

File yang mempunyai format html dibaca langsung oleh Browser. Disini, peran browser sebenarnya adalah “penterjemah” dari dokumen-dokumen yang ditulis dengan aturan kode HTML.

Ini berbeda dengan program scripting dimana script dijalankan terlebih dahulu oleh server, di server sesuai dengan perintahnya dan kemudian hasil olahan script misalnya yang digunakan adalah PHP script dikirimkan ke browser. Browser akan membacanya sesuai dengan hasil olahan PHP. Jika script php mempunyai kesalahan operasi maka dokumen yang tampil juga akan menunjukkan kesalahan.

Program php adalah scripting program harus diterjemahkan oleh [[WebServer]] melalui suatu Pre-Processor (semacam modul intepreter). Jadi, kalau Anda punya web-server tapi tidak memasang php processor, web server Anda belum bisa menjalankan script php. Hasil akhir script php biasanya dalam bentuk html yang diterima browser.

Program dengan script php dapat berdiri sendiri ataupun disisipkan di antara kode-kode html. Bahkan dapat juga dikombinasikan dengan kode script yang berbeda asalkan lingkungan servernya mendukung hal tersebut.

PHP merupakan bahasa pemograman web yang bersifat [[ServerSide]] HTML=embedded scripting, di mana script-nya menyatu dengan HTML dan berada si server.
Tipe Data PHP

Tipe data yang dapat diolah PHP adalah :
  • Integer : terdiri dari angka bulat positip dan negatif
  • Floating Point : terdiri dari angka pecahan
  • String : terdiri dari huruf atau teks dengan pemberian ‘ atau “
  • Objek : terdiri dari data dan method yang mempunyai objek
  • Array : terdiri dari sekumpulan angka yang sejenis
  • Boolean : terdiri dari true dan false

Operator PHP
  • Operator Aritmatika : + , - , * , / , %
  • Operator Increment dan Decrement : ++ $a, $a++, - - $a, $a - -
  • Operator Logika : &, or, xor, !, &&, | |
  • Operator Perbandingan : = =, = = =, !=, != =, <, >, <=, >=
  • Operator Ternary : (Ekspresi1) ? (Ekspresi2) : (Ekspresi3);
  • Operator Eksekusi : backticks ( ` ` ) atau tanda apostrophe (kutip) terbalik.
  • Operator Assignment : Operator assignment adalah “ = “, yang berarti operand disebelah kiri mendapatkan dari operand sebelah kanan.
  • Operator String : $a . $b

2 komentar:

Mr.1625 mengatakan...

okey gan,, makasih buat infonya, sangat membantu buat saya yang lagi belajar... makasih sekali lagi.. tukar link mau gak ni?
sry gan PERTAMAX.....

Lutfie Nanda mengatakan...

ok ok.....

boleh2 saja kok silahkan!!!

Posting Komentar